Youm2006 - Mathematical Pacemaker Activity Recorded Mouse Small Lab

About lab

Source-faithful physiology lab for Youm, Kim, Han, Kim, Joo, Leem, Goto, Noma, Earm, 2006. Public controls and outputs are mapped to real source symbols for electrophysiology.
